In Court, an attorney is an advocate representing his/her client’s legal rights.
At Mediation, the attorney’s role is to obtain the most favorable and acceptable agreement for his/her client while presenting his/her legal position.
A mediator is totally neutral and does not provide ANY legal advice to either side.
